NGC 3669
|
Object NGC 3669 is located exactly in the center of the picture.
|
NGC 3669 - galaxy in the constellation Ursae Majoris Type: SBcd - spiral galaxy with bar The angular dimensions: 2.00'x0.5' magnitude: V=12.4m; B=13.1m The surface brightness: 12.3 mag/arcmin2 Coordinates for epoch J2000: Ra= 11h25m26.5s; Dec= 57°43'17" redshift (z): 0.006471 The distance from the Sun to NGC 3669: based on the amount of redshift (z) - 27.3 Mpc; Other names of the object NGC 3669 : PGC 35113, UGC 6431, MCG 10-16-135, CGCG 291-67, IRAS 11226+5759
